How you answer this age-old question about positive thinking may reflect your way of thinking. Today let's see how you can Transition from a fixed mindset to a growth mindset and enhance your life.
1.Awareness: Recognize when you're operating from a fixed mindset. Pay attention to your thoughts and reactions, especially in challenging situations or when facing criticism.
2.Challenge Your Beliefs: Question your assumptions about intelligence and abilities. Remind yourself that talents and skills can be developed through effort and learning.
3.Embrace Challenges: Instead of avoiding challenges, seek them out. View them as opportunities for growth and learning, rather than threats to your self-image.
4.Learn from Failure: Shift your perspective on failure. See it as a natural part of the learning process and an opportunity to gain valuable insights and improve.
5.Value Effort: Cultivate a mindset that values effort and persistence. Recognize that success is not solely determined by innate talent, but also by dedication and hard work.
6.Seek Feedback: Be open to feedback, both positive and constructive criticism. Use it as an opportunity to learn and grow, rather than as a reflection of your worth.
7.Celebrate Progress: Focus on progress rather than perfection. Celebrate your achievements, no matter how small, and acknowledge the effort you've put on.
8.Surround Yourself with Growth-Minded People: Surround yourself with individuals who embody a growth mindset. Their positivity and determination can inspire and support your own journey of growth.
